Transaction f66aefc7d2a83fa0cb7d55d5fcb98ee0e570c40824b24f86a5982740592f82e6
1 Input
1 Output
-
f66aefc7d2a83fa0cb7d55d5fcb98ee0e570c40824b24f86a5982740592f82e6:0
- value
- 2004146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 431d72711322ba2f808c811a8de69e580a75ef9e OP_EQUALVERIFY OP_CHECKSIG
- address
- 177sYsPJfhtYdTXEEgPYkupWSNN1qDALvZ